Discover the secrets of nature at our many interpretation sites and centres. Go for a trail hike at of the most important rock art (pictograph) sites in North America, learn all about the history of beer and the brewing industry in the Outaouais region, indulge your sweet tooth at Quebec’s only Chocolate Economuseum, or visit a hydro generating station in the heart of downtown Gatineau!
